Høgskoleni østfold EKSAMEN

Like dokumenter
Høgskoleni østfold EKSAMEN. Tom Heine Nårtt Eksamensoppgaven: Oppgavesettet består av 7 sider inkludert denne forsiden, og er inndelt i tre deler.

EKSAMEN. Noen spørsmål kan besvares som punktlister. Prøv her å strukturere svaret slik at hvert punkt omhandler ett tema/element.

Oppgave 1 (Etter forelesning 31/8) Gå gjennom nettsiden arngren.net og list opp alle problemene du ser. Både i funksjonalitet/bruk og i koden bak.

Høgskoleni østfold EKSAMEN

Høgskoleni østfold EKSAMEN

EKSAMEN. Webutvikling Dato: ITF Eksamenstid: 25/ Hjelpemidler: Faglærer: Ingen. Tom Heine Nätt

EKSAMEN (Konvertert fra en gammel PHP-eksamen)

SENSORVEILEDNING. Dato: Eventuelt:

Høgskoleni østfold EKSAMEN. Emne: Innføring i programmering

Hjelpemidler: 4 A4-sider (2 to-sidige ark eller 4 en-sidige ark) med egenproduserte notater (håndskrevne/maskinskrevne)

Eksamensoppgaven: Oppgavesettet består av fire deler: DEL 1: Påstander, DEL 2: Flervalg, DEL 3: Kodeoppgave og DEL 4: Langsvar.

EKSAMEN ITF Webprogrammering 1 Dato: Eksamenstid: Hjelpemidler: 2 A4 ark (4 sider) med egenproduserte notater (håndskrevne/maskinskrevne)

OBLIG 2 WEBUTVIKLING

EKSAMEN. Emne: Webprogrammering med PHP (kont.) Webprogrammering 1 (kont.) Eksamenstid:

OBLIG 1 - WEBUTVIKLING

EKSAMEN. Les gjennom alle oppgavene før du begynner. Husk at det ikke er gitt at oppgavene står sortert etter økende vanskelighetsgrad.

Oblig 1. Oppgave 1. Gå gjennom nettsiden arngren.net og list opp alle problemene du ser. Både i funksjonalitet/bruk og i koden bak.

EKSAMEN (Konvertert fra en gammel PHPeksamen)

EKSAMEN (Konvertert fra en gammel PHP-eksamen)

Høgskoleni østfold EKSAMEN

EKSAMEN Web-publisering

EKSAMEN. Emne: Webprogrammering med PHP (kont.) Webprogrammering 1 (kont.) Eksamenstid:

Oppgave 1: Gå gjennom nettsiden arngren.net og list opp alle problemene du ser. Både i funksjonalitet/bruk og i koden bak.

EKSAMEN. Emne: Innføring i informasjons- og kommunikasjonsteknologi

Høgskoleni østfold EKSAMEN. ITF10213 Innføring i programmering (Høst 2013)

OBLIG 1 WEBUTVIKLING. Oppgave 1 Gå gjennom nettsiden arngren.net og list opp alle problemene du ser. Både i funksjonalitet/bruk og i koden bak.

Oppgave 1. Gå gjennom nettsiden arngren.net og list opp alle problemene du ser. Både i funksjonalitet/bruk og i koden bak.

r) Høgskoleni Østfold

EKSAMEN. Evaluering av IT-systemer. Eksamenstid: kl 0900 til kl 1300

INF1040 Oppgavesett 4: CSS

Høgskoleni østfold NY/UTSATT EKSAMEN

EKSAMEN / 6101N WebPublisering

efs) Høgskoleni Øs fold

EKSAMEN. Objektorientert programmering

Steg 1: Vi starter fra toppen

TENK TECH SUMMERCAMP BYGG DIN EGEN NETTSIDE

HTML-del. 1. <!-- ikke slett min kode, vær så snill --> er a) en HTML stil-tag b) en CSS stil-tag c) en HTML kommentar-tag d) en CSS kommentar-tag

Høgskoleni østfold EKSAMEN. Oppgavesettet består av 7 oppgaver. Alle oppgavene skal besvares. Oppgavene teller som oppgitt ved sensurering.

Oblig 2: Oppgave 1. section { width: 50%; height: 30%; margin: 5% 0 0 0; } h1 { color:#000000; font-size:2em;

I denne oppgaven skal du lære hvordan du kan flytte rundt på elementer og gjemme elementene bak andre elementer ved hjelp av CSS.

Oblig 3 Webutvikling. Oppgave 1

Oppgave 1. Index Mobil. About me Mobil

EKSAMEN. Dato: 9. mai 2016 Eksamenstid: 09:00 13:00

Dersom noen oppgaver er så vanskelige at du ikke vet hvordan du skal løse de, gjør forenklinger og forklar nøye hva du har forenklet/tatt bort.

EKSAMEN Webpublisering

Responsiv design Skalering av siden trenger å gjøres noe med, slik at den er tilpasset de fleste skjermstørrelser.

(X)HTML, CSS og JavaScript HTML. Det første dokumentet Grunnleggende programmering i Java Monica Strand 26.

består av 7 sider inklusiv denne forsiden og vedlegg. Kontroller at oppgaven er komplett før du begynner å besvare spørsmålene.

Forelesning 23/9-08 Webprog 1. Tom Heine Nätt

Høgskoleni østfold EKSAMEN. LSV1MAT12 Matematikk Vl: Tall, algebra og funksjoner 1

HTML: Del inn nettsiden

EKSAMEN. Oppgavesettet består av 16 oppgaver. Ved sensur vil alle oppgaver telle like mye med unntak av oppgave 6 som teller som to oppgaver.

Oblig 1 Erlend Hannestad

EKSAMEN. Operativsystemer. 1. Læreboken "A Practical Guide to Red Hat Linux" av Mark Sobell 2. Maks. tre A-4 ark med selvskrevne notater.

EKSAMEN. Emne: Algoritmer og datastrukturer

EKSAMEN. Emne: Algoritmer og datastrukturer

EKSAMEN. Algoritmer og datastrukturer

EKSAMEN. Emne: Emnekode: Matematikk for IT ITF Dato: Eksamenstid: til desember Hjelpemidler: Faglærer:

EKSAMEN. Emnekode: Emne: Matematikk for IT ITF Eksamenstid: Dato: kl til kl desember Hjelpemidler: Faglærer:

Webutvikling Oblig 3. Oppgave 1

EKSAMEN. Oppgavesettet består av 11 oppgaver med i alt 21 deloppgaver. Ved sensur vil alle deloppgaver telle omtrent like mye.

HTML: Legg til lyd og video

I denne oppgaven forventer vi at du har vært gjennom HTML- og CSS-oppgavene så langt og/eller er kjent med <div> - og HTML5-taggene.

Høgskoleni østfold EKSAMEN. LSV1MAT12 Vl: Tall og algebra, funksjoner 1. Dato: Eksamenstid: kl til kl

Oppgavesettet består av 7 sider, inkludert denne forsiden. Kontroll& at oppgaven er komplett før du begynner å besvare spørsmålene.

CSS-formatering: stilark med kommentarer

EKSAMEN. Oppgavesettet består av 9 oppgaver med i alt 20 deloppgaver. Ved sensur vil alle deloppgaver telle omtrent like mye.

EKSAMEN. Emne: Innføring i informasjons- og kommunikasjonsteknologi

Høgskoleni østfold EKSAMEN. Samfunnsvitenskapelig forskningsmetode. Eksamenssettet består av seks ark (inkludert denne forsiden).

Høgskoleni Østfold. Ny/utsatt EKSAMEN

FINANSREGNSKAP med IKT 7,5 sp (ØABED1000) BEDRIFTSØKONOMI I med IKT 10 sp (ØABED6000)

Høgskoleni østfold EKSAMEN. V3: Tall og algebra, funksjoner 2 ( trinn) Dato: Eksamenstid: Fra kl til kl

EKSAMEN. Oppgavesettet består av 9 oppgaver med i alt 21 deloppgaver. Ved sensur vil alle deloppgaver telle omtrent like mye.

Oblig 3 Webutvikling

WEBUTVIKLING OBLIG 4. Installasjon

EKSAMEN. Tall og algebra, funksjoner 2

EKSAMEN. Bildebehandling og mønstergjenkjenning

Webutvikling oblig 1 Marius Hanssen

Oppbygging av innhold på responsive nettsider.

Høgskolen i Telemark EKSAMEN Webpublisering (inkludert denne) Hjelpemiddel: Ingen

Løsningsforslag til EKSAMEN

Høgskoleni østfold EKSAMEN. Hjelpem idler: Faglærer: Kåre Sorteberg Ingen hjelpemidler. Monica Kristiansen

Høgskoleni østfold EKSAMEN

Intro til WWW, HTML5 og CSS

EKSAMEN. Emne: Datakommunikasjon

Høgskoleni østfold EKSAMEN

EKSAMEN (Del 1, høsten 2015)

Oblig 1 Webutvikling av Jon-Håkon Rabben

Løsningsforslag. Emnekode: Emne: Matematikk for IT ITF Eksamenstid: Dato: kl til kl desember Hjelpemidler: Faglærer:

EKSAMEN. Emne: V1: Tall og algebra, funksjoner 1. Eksamenstid: 6 timer, kl til kl

EKSAMEN. Emne: Innføring i informasjons- og kommunikasjonsteknologi

EKSAMEN Løsningsforslag. med forbehold om bugs :-)

EKSAMEN. Algoritmer og datastrukturer. Eksamensoppgaven: Oppgavesettet består av 11 sider inklusiv vedlegg og denne forsiden.

Høgskoleni østfold EKSAMEN

13/21. Høgskoleni østfold EKSAMEN. Emnekode: Emne: LSMATAF213 V3: Tall, algebra, funksjoner 2

Høgskoleni østfold EKSAMEN. LSVIMAT12 Matematikk 1, V 1: Tall og algebra. funksjoner 1. Dato: 16. desember Eksamenstid: kl til kl 15.

Høgskoleni østfold EKSAMEN. Dato: Eksamenstid: kl til kl. 1200

EKSAMEN med løsningsforslag

Cr) Høgskoleni østfold

Emnenavn: Datateknikk. Eksamenstid: 3 timer. Faglærer: Robert Roppestad. består av 5 sider inklusiv denne forsiden, samt 1 vedleggside.

Transkript:

Høgskoleni østfold EKSAMEN Emnekode: Emne: ITF10511 Webutvikling Dato: Eksamenstid: 03/12-2014 09.00-13.00 Hjelpemidler: Faglærer: In en Tom Heine Nått Eksamensoppgaven: Oppgavesettet består av 6 sider inkludert denne forsiden, og er inndelt i tre deler. Det er på hver del angitt hvor stor andel denne teller av totalen. Karakter fastsettes på basis av en helhetsvurdering av besvarelsen. På alle spørsmål er det viktig at du svarer presist. Dette fordi det er forholdsvis dårlig tid, men også fordi måten du besvarer et spørsmål på vil være med på å vise hvor godt du behersker temaet. Husk at hensikten er å vise sensor at du forstår temaet, ikke skrive en "håndbok". Du bør fokusere spesielt på at det du skriver gir mening og ikke bare er "fyllmateriale". Felles for alle oppgaver er at det ikke er noen "ro-poeng" å hente. Du kan ha svart med mye tekst uten å få noe uttelling, eller få full uttelling for forholdsvis lite tekst. Uttellingen avhenger av kvaliteten på svaret, og ikke mengden. Til enkelte oppgaver står det spesielle instruksjoner til hvordan du skal svare. Disse er skrevet i et skri t med understrekin. Til enkelte oppgaver er det også i en igråboks1gitt et eksempel på hvordan du skal presentere svaret. Noen spørsmål bes besvart som punktlister. Prøv her å strukturere svaret slik at hvert punkt handler om ett tema/element. NB! Det er svært viktig at du skriver slik at det er lett å tyde/forstå for sensorene. Dersom man under sensur ikke klarer å tyde/forstå hva som står skrevet, får man ikke uttelling for disse delene av teksten. Takk for et hyggelig semester, og god juleferie:-) Lykke til! Sensurdato: 06/01-2015 Karakterene cr tilgjengelige for studenter på studentweb senest 2 virkedager etter oppgitt sensurfrist. Følg instruksjoner gitt på: www.hiofino/studentweb Side 1 av 6

Del 1: Påstander (25 %) I besvarelsen din skal du å denne delen skrive en di e svar rikti / eil å ortnen: Riktig Feil Riktig Feil osv.. Vær nøye med at det ikke blir noen uklarheter om hva du har svart på de ulike oppgavene. Eventuelle "helgarderinger" teller som feil svar. Mener du det er tvetydigheter eller at påstanden er upresis, så skriv tydelig de to måtene du ser å lese påstanden på, og hvilke av mulighetene du anser som riktig/feil. Dette skal det imidlertid ikke være behov for å gjøre slik oppgavesettet er ment utformet. Husk at du skal vurdere påstanden slik den står. Noen påstander kan være delvis riktige, men inneholder noe som gjør de feil totalt sett. NB! Feil svar teller tilsvarende negativt, så om du ikke kan svaret er det IKKE lonnsomt å gjette. Media Queries kommer ikke til å erstatte medietypene slik som screen, all og print, men er et tillegg til disse. Begrepene/teknologiene Internett og Web (World Wide Web) dukket opp samtidig. CSS og HTML ble begge funnet opp samtidig, men HTML har hatt en raskere utgivelse av versjoner og derfor kommet til versjon 5 mot CSS sin versjon 3. W3C er en organisasjon som blant annet arbeider frem standardene HTML og CSS. Taggen <f igure> er til for å tegne grafikk (figurer) på en nettside via Javascript Ved å benytte taggen <t ime> i nettsiden vil nettleseren automatisk sette inn tidspunkt og dato formatert slik det er beskrevet i attributtet format etter standarden ISO-8601 I forbindelse med domenenavn er TLD det formelle navnet på.com,.no,. net,.eu osv. Begrepet padding i CSS er en betegnelse på "fyllet" utenfor kantlinjene (border), mens margin er betegnelsen på "fyllet" mellom innholdet og kantlinjene Når vi setter egenskapene width og height er det (som standard) på hele "boksen" i css. Altså innhold, margin, padding og border. Så sant det lar seg gjøre bør et nettsted utelukkende bestå av absolutte linker. Relative linker vil gjøre at siden blir vanskeligere å flytte til en annen webserver. FTP er en teknologi som kan benyttes til å flytte filer fra lokal maskin til webserveren. Side 2 av 6

Å ha filnavn som inneholder store bokstaver, æ,ø,å, mellomrom og spesialtegn støttes ikke av standarden, og vil derfor alltid medføre at nettsiden ikke fungerer på en webserver. Dersom vi gjør endringer på en webside i forhold til SE0 må vi ofte vente flere minutter (i helt spesielle tilfeller helt opp til en time) før vi ser resultater av dette i en søkemotor. Site Authority i forbindelse med SE0 er et annet navn på de som drifter nettsiden. CSS Webfonts er fonter som lastes ned som en ekstern ressurs til nettsiden. Canonical i forbindelse med SE0 betyr at søkemotoren oppfatter ulike visninger av den samme nettsiden som helt ulike nettsider og dermed duplikat innhold. Å indentere koden i HTML/CSS er viktig for å få nettsiden validert. Ettersom bilder er et graflsk element (design) på en nettside er metoden med å sette inn bilder via CSS på sikt ment å erstatte <img>-taggen i HTML. Foreløpig er vi imidlertid i en overgangsperiode der begge er tillatt. Følgende er et eksempel på en pseudo class i CSS: gimport url('stor.css') (min-width:800px); Med begrepet responsive web design mener vi at nettsiden responderer på ulike skjermstørrelser ved å skalere og omstrukturere seg. Side 3 av 6

Del 2 - HTML/CSS/PHP (30%) C4Dmpbre2.1(5%) Du har følgende HTML-kode (kun body vises): <body> <div id="dela" <h1>a</hi> <p>a1</p> <p class="t">a2</p> <p class="t">a3</p> <p class="t">a4</p> </div> <div id="delb" <h1>b</h1> </div> </body> <p class="t">b2</p> <p class="t">b3</p> <p class="t">b4</p> Skriv CSS-selectors som matcher taggene med følgende innhold: A, B A I, A2, A3, A4, B I, B2, B3, B4 Al, A2, A3, A4 A2, A3, A4, B2, B3, B4 A2, A3, A4 Du kan anta at websiden aldri vil inneholde noe mer/andre data enn det som er der nå. Svar ved å skrive o avebokstav o selve selectoren altså ikke o med innhold : img div img Side 4 av 6

Oppgave 2.2 (10%) Skriv et minimalt HTML5 dokument (uten CSS) med tittelen "Test" og som viser teksten "Hei" i en paragraf. Hvilke endringer skal gjøres i HTML-filen for å koble inn et eksternt CSS-dokument med filnavnet stiless, og hva skulle innholdet i denne fila vært dersom teksten "Hei" skulle blitt rød. Oppgave 2.3 (10%) Forklar kort følgende: Hvilken effekt/hensikt har hver av følgende fire tegnsekvenser i HTML: < > & " Hva betyr følgende kode: @media all and (min-width: 800px) p { font-weight: bold; } Hva benyttes følgende tagger til: <blockquote> <abbr> <main> Forklar hva følgende CSS - egenskaper benyttes til: z-index clear font-family Oppgave 2.4 (5 %) Forklar kort følgende begreper i forbindelse med webprogrammering: Client-side og server-side programmering Sesjoner GET og POST Side 5 av 6

Del 3 - Langsvar (45%) Skriv kort og presist, men med mye innhold, det du vet om følgende tre tema. Denne delen blir bedømt ut i fra kunnskapen du viser om temaet gjennom det du skriver. Husk at kunnskap om et tema også vises gjennom at teksten er presist formulert og godt strukturert. Du har ca 1,5 timer til rådighet på denne oppgaven og de tre temaene. Pass på å fordele tiden noenlunde likt (altså ca 30 min på hver). Omfanget av svarene bør stå i stil med denne tiden. Du vil umulig klare å skrive en komplett oversikt over temaene på tiden du har til rådighet. Forsøk isteden å fokusere på å få vist frem bredden og dybden i kunnskapen din (dvs. dropp det enkleste). Tema 1 - Struktur og Semantikk Du må som et minimum ha med følgende: Hva menes det med at en nettside har god struktur og god semantikk? Hvorfor ønsker man at en nettside skal ha god struktur og god semantikk? Ulike måter for å få bedre semantikk i en nettside Innhold kontra utseende Microdata Semantic web Tema 2 - SE0 Du må som et minimum ha med følgende: Hvordan en SEO-prosess kan foregå (overordnet/generelt) Ulike faktorer ved en nettside som kan påvirke en nettsides rangering Ulike ytre/eksterne faktorer som kan påvirke en nettsides rangering Utfordringer når det gjelder SE0 Sammenhengen mellom SE0 og tilgjengelighet Tema 3 - CMS Du må som et minimum ha med følgende: Forklar med egne ord hva et CMS er Hvorfor vi kan ønske å bruke et CMS Hva krever et CMS av brukere og hva krever det av webdesignere/utviklere Sikkerhetsutfordringer ved bruk av CMS Fordeler og ulemper med bruk av CMS Side 6 av 6